					<description><![CDATA[<p>Last year (2019) we had our first goose egg of the season on 25th February 2019, this year it was today, 26th February! It&#8217;s amazing how nature&#8217;s clock is so accurate. It won&#8217;t be long before we have a goose eggs for sale (sorry, still local collection only). I know what I am having for [&#8230;]</p>
